									53
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:53|
									And they did not receive him, because his face was [turned  as] going to Jerusalem.									
									    
								 
- 
									
									54
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:54|
									And his disciples James and John seeing [it] said, Lord,  wilt thou that we speak [that] fire come down from heaven and  consume them, as also Elias did?									
									    
								 
- 
									
									55
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:55|
									But turning he rebuked them [and said, Ye know not of what  spirit ye are].									
									    
								 
- 
									
									56
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:56|
									And they went to another village.									
									    
								 
- 
									
									57
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:57|
									And it came to pass as they went in the way, one said to  him, I will follow thee wheresoever thou goest, Lord.									
									    
								 
- 
									
									58
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:58|
									And Jesus said to him, The foxes have holes and the birds  of the heaven roosting-places, but the Son of man has not where  he may lay his head.									
									    
								 
- 
									
									59
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:59|
									And he said to another, Follow me. But he said, Lord, allow  me to go first and bury my father.									
									    
								 
- 
									
									60
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:60|
									But Jesus said to him, Suffer the dead to bury their own  dead, but do *thou* go and announce the kingdom of God.									
									    
								 
- 
									
									61
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:61|
									And another also said, I will follow thee, Lord, but first  allow me to bid adieu to those at my house.									
									    
								 
- 
									
									62
									 
									 
									|Lucas 9:62|
									But Jesus said to him, No one having laid his hand on [the]  plough and looking back is fit for the kingdom of God.
